Buy a Home in BristolLocated in the heart of Elkhart County, the historic town of Bristol, Indiana pairs a comfortable, small-town lifestyle with a long list of attractions that the whole family will enjoy. Whether you're looking to spend some time enjoying the natural beauty of Bristol, experiencing arts and culture at historic venues, or relaxing on the water, you'll find what you're looking for close to home in Bristol. Our real estate agents know the community, and we've put together five reasons why you'll love getting to know Bristol too.

Discovering The Best about Buying a Home in Bristol

  1. Visit the Elkhart Civic Theatre at the Bristol Opera House to Enjoy Arts and Culture
    Looking to enjoy arts and culture, without having to travel to the big city? Bristol has you covered! The Elkhart Civic Theater at the Bristol Opera House has been delighting audiences for decades, with plays and performances that the whole family will love. There is a long list of plays to enjoy on every season's schedule, with performances that will appeal to every age-group. You'll also find plenty of opportunities to volunteer at the Elkhart Civic Theatre, whether you're looking to support the shows or get involved in the performances yourself.

  2. The Elkhart County Historical Museum Brings Bristol History to Life
    Bristol may be a small town, but it's got a big history. There are so many stories to be told, dating all the way back to the days when Bristol was founded in 1835, and the Elkhart County Historical Museum does a great job of bringing those stories to life. Located in Bristol, the Elkhart County Historical Museum is filled with fascinating exhibits and opportunities to get hands-on with local history.

  3. Family Fun and Outdoor Adventures at Bonneyville Mill County Park
    There's tons of small-town charm to be found around Bristol, and Bonneyville Mill County Park is a great example of why that's the case. Experience a historic, beautifully preserved mill and farm, with plenty of great spots for a picnic. Bonneyville Mill County Park is also home mountain biking and hiking trails, fishing spots along the Little Elkhart River, acres of beautiful, natural scenery, and even a pair of sledding hills for family fun during the winter. No matter the season, you'll find fun at Bonneyville Mill County Park.

  4. Enjoy Lazy Dayz on the St. Joe River in Bristol
    Running through the heart of Bristol, you'll find the scenic Saint Joe River, one of the community's favorite destinations for outdoor fun. Bring your own canoe or kayak, or rent one from a local business like Lazy Dayz, then spend a peaceful, leisurely day exploring all of the beautiful sights that Bristol has to offer.

  5. Linton's Enchanted Gardens for Shopping, Food, Fun, and Fabulous Landscaping
    When you're shopping for Bristol homes for sale, you may notice that homes in the area tend to have great curb appeal. Linton's Enchanted Gardens – a one-stop shop for all of your landscaping needs – is a big reason why that's the case. In addition to all of the great landscaping products at Linton's, you'll find a garden cafe, interior décor, and a wedding/event space. There are also great activities for the kids, including an enchanted train ride, go karts, gemstone mining, a petting zoo, and paddle boats on Lake Linton.
